According to the research report titled, 'Europe Pet Food Protein Ingredients Market by Source (Animal Byproducts, Feed Grains, Soybean Byproducts, Novel Proteins), by Application (Dry Foods, Wet Foods, Veterinary Diets, Treats and Snacks) - Forecast to 2036,' the Europe pet food protein ingredients market is expected to reach approximately USD 4.72 billion by 2036 from USD 2.68 billion in 2026, at a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period (2026-2036). The report provides an in-depth analysis of the Europe pet food protein ingredients market across major European countries, emphasizing the current market trends, market sizes, recent developments, and forecasts till 2036.

Following extensive secondary and primary research and an in-depth analysis of the market scenario, the report conducts the impact analysis of the key industry drivers, restraints, opportunities, and challenges. The major factors driving the growth of the Europe pet food protein ingredients market include increasing pet population, growing trend of pet humanization, rising demand for premium and specialized pet food products, and growing awareness about pet nutrition importance. Additionally, rising demand for novel and alternative protein sources, increasing focus on sustainable and ethically sourced ingredients, and growing demand for specialized and functional pet food products are expected to create significant growth opportunities for players operating in the Europe pet food protein ingredients market.

Based on Source

By source, the animal byproducts segment is expected to account for the largest share of the market in 2026. Animal byproducts, such as meat and bone meal, poultry byproduct meal, and fish meal, are traditional and cost-effective sources of protein for pet food. They are widely available and provide a good balance of essential amino acids. However, novel protein sources are expected to witness the fastest growth among all source segments, driven by concerns about sustainability of traditional animal-based proteins and demand for hypoallergenic and functional pet food products.

Based on Application

By application, the dry pet foods segment is expected to account for the largest share of the market in 2026. Dry pet food is convenient, has a long shelf life, and is generally more affordable than wet pet food. It is also beneficial for dental health, as the crunchy texture helps to clean teeth and reduce tartar buildup. The wide availability and variety of dry pet food products contribute to the growth of this segment. Wet foods, veterinary diets, and treats and snacks represent other important application categories.

Geographic Analysis

An in-depth geographic analysis of the industry provides detailed qualitative and quantitative insights into major European countries. Germany is projected to account for the largest share of the Europe pet food protein ingredients market during the forecast period, supported by a large and well-established pet population, high per capita expenditure on pet care and nutrition, and a mature and technologically advanced pet food manufacturing industry. France and Spain are expected to register some of the fastest growth rates, driven by rising pet ownership levels, increasing disposable incomes, growing trend toward pet humanization, and increasing awareness regarding protein quality and functional benefits. Expanding retail distribution networks, growth of specialty pet food brands, and rising availability of premium and veterinary diet products are also contributing to stronger demand for advanced protein ingredients across Europe.
